Giving Strength to the Weary & Hope for a Future

Tulsa Girls’ Home (QRTP home) provides a safe, structured, and nurturing environment for girls ages 14–18 who are in DHS foster care. Designed as a therapeutic residential setting, our program serves girls who have experienced trauma, instability, and disrupted placements—offering them not just a place to stay, but a place to begin again.

At Tulsa Girls’ Home, we focus on healing, stability, trauma-informed treatment and growth. Through individualized support, and consistent relationships, girls are given the opportunity to rebuild trust, develop life skills, and work toward a healthy, independent future. Our team walks alongside each resident, providing guidance in education, emotional regulation, healthy relationships, and personal responsibility.

Girls in foster care, especially teens, are among the most vulnerable in the system. Many have experienced multiple placements, loss of connection, and deep emotional trauma. Without the right level of care and consistency, they are at a significantly higher risk for poor outcomes, including homelessness, exploitation, mental health challenges, and lack of long-term stability.

Tulsa Girls’ Home exists to change that trajectory.

We provide more than supervision—we provide consistency in a world that has often been inconsistent. We offer structure where there has been chaos, and connection where there has been loss. Our home creates space for girls to be seen, known, and supported as they work through their past and begin to believe in their future.

Treatment Rooted in Healing and Hope

At Tulsa Girls’ Home, our services are designed to meet each girl where she is—providing safety, healing, and the tools needed for long-term success. Through trauma-informed treatmnet, therapeutic support, education, life skills development, and health coordination, we walk alongside each young woman as she builds confidence, stability, and a path forward.

  • A safe, structured home environment with 24/7 support, designed to promote stability, emotional safety, and healing.

  • Access to licensed therapists and coordinated family engagement to address trauma, build coping skills, and strengthen healthy relationships.

  • Partnership with local schools, tutoring, and advocacy to help girls stay on track academically and work toward graduation.

  • Hands-on guidance in budgeting, hygiene, time management, communication, and decision-making to prepare for adulthood.
